The Sun in August 2025: A Month of Two Halves

Prepare to be mesmerized by the dynamic nature of our nearest star! A captivating video from helioviewer.org offers a glimpse into the Sun's appearance throughout the entire month of August 2025. What unfolds is a narrative of two distinct halves, marked by a notable increase in visual activity as the month progressed.

The Sun on August 2025

This celestial display reveals that while the Sun became visually more active towards the end of August, this surge in activity did not directly translate to an expected increase in solar flares. It's a fascinating reminder of the complex and sometimes unpredictable processes occurring on our star.
